The Impact of Untreated Water

Untreated water can harbor a variety of elements that interfere with brewing processes. For instance, hard water can lead to scale buildup within heat exchangers and boilers, increasing energy costs and maintenance requirements. Additionally, impurities in water may lead to off-flavors in beer, which can compromise a brewery's reputation and sales. Recognizing these challenges underscores the necessity of investing in effective water treatment solutions.

Understanding Demand and Duty Cycle

Breweries experience both peak and average demand cycles, which directly influence the sizing of water treatment equipment. During peak production times, such as when brewing large batches or bottling, water demand can surge dramatically. Therefore, it's crucial to size equipment not just for average daily usage, but also to account for these peak periods.

The duty cycle—defined as the ratio of the time the equipment is in operation to the total time in a given period—affects selection and performance. Operators should consider how frequently the equipment will run and the volume of water required during these times to ensure optimal treatment capability and efficiency.

Flow Rate and Capacity Selection

Proper flow rate (GPM) and capacity (grains per day, GPD) are vital for ensuring that your brewing process runs smoothly. Calculate the necessary flow rate by assessing the combined water needs for brewing, cleaning, and other operational processes. Remember, oversizing your water treatment system can lead to unnecessary expenses, while undersizing can result in operational downtime and compromised product quality.

Redundancy and Configuration Options

Considering redundancy is key when selecting water treatment systems. Implementing duplex or alternating configurations allows for continuous operation, ensuring that production is not halted due to maintenance or equipment failure. This is especially crucial for breweries that operate around the clock, where reliability can directly impact profitability.

Pretreatment Requirements

Pretreatment can significantly enhance the efficiency and longevity of your water treatment system. Different treatment technologies may require specific pretreatment steps to ensure optimal performance. For instance, sediment filtration may be needed to remove particulates before water is softened, while carbon filtration could be necessary to eliminate chlorine. Understanding these needs in advance will help you design a comprehensive treatment solution tailored to your facility’s requirements.

Specification Questions Before Purchasing

Prior to purchasing a water treatment system, consider the following specification questions:

  • What is the average and peak water demand of the brewery?
  • What contaminants are present in the incoming water supply?
  • What is the desired water quality for brewing operations?
  • What is the operational schedule, and how does it impact water usage?
  • What is the available space for equipment installation?
  • How often can maintenance be performed, and what resources are available?
  • Are there any specific pretreatment requirements based on the equipment selected?

Taking the time to answer these questions will position your brewery to choose the most effective water treatment solution, ensuring that your brewing process remains efficient, reliable, and consistent.
